Nubians bringing Baboon and Cheetah as tribute.  Detail of a wallpainting in the tomb of Rekhmere, vizier the Pharaohs Thutmosis III and Amenophis II (18th Dynasty, 16th-14th BCE), in the cemetery of Sheikh Abd al-Qurnah. 
Location Tomb of Rekhmere/Sheikh Abd el-Qurna/Tomb of Nobles/Thebes/
